ActionAid Association (AAA) is seeking a Consultant – Project Manager to lead end-to-end planning, implementation, and monitoring of livelihood, housing, and green technology projects in Wayanad district, Kerala.
The role involves managing project teams, partners, and technical agencies; overseeing tranche-linked milestone verification; ensuring financial compliance; and building institutional sustainability of nine livelihood units, HASAKE, and the CRC as community-owned structures.
About ActionAid Association: ActionAid Association (AAA) is a national organization working in India since 2006 with work across 25 States and two Union Territories. For more details, please visit https://www.actionaidindia.org
Key Responsibilities
Lead end-to-end planning, implementation, and monitoring of all project components across Wayanad district.
Ensure timely achievement and credible verification of all tranche-linked milestones set out in Schedule II of the agreement, on which further disbursement depends.
Manage project teams, partners, and technical agencies to deliver quality outputs across livelihoods, housing repair, entitlements, and green technology components.
Responsible for managing and coordinating livelihood support initiatives, including market linkages, marketing, branding, product promotion, and enterprise development.
Ensure sound financial management, utilisation and compliance, including the 80% utilisation thresholds that trigger subsequent tranches.
Maintain a strong, transparent relationship with donors and other stakeholders through accurate monthly, quarterly, and final reporting.
Build the institutional sustainability of the nine livelihood units, HASAKE, and the CRC as community-owned structures.
Required Qualifications
Master’s degree in Social Work, Rural Development, Development Studies, Management, or a related discipline.
Minimum 7-10 years of experience in development programme management, of which at least 3 years in a project leadership role managing multi-component, multi-crore CSR or institutionally funded projects.
Demonstrated experience in disaster rehabilitation, livelihoods promotion, collective enterprise development, or community resource management, preferably in Kerala or comparable rural and tribal contexts.
Proven track record of milestone-based donor reporting, budget management, procurement oversight, and audit compliance.
Experience working with government departments, LSGIs, technical institutions, and MSME/cooperative structures.
Strong team leadership, conflict resolution, and stakeholder management skills.
Proficiency in English for donor reporting; working knowledge of Malayalam is highly desirable given the tribal and rural community focus in Wayanad.
Competence in MS Office, digital data collection tools, and MIS/reporting systems.
Willingness to be based in Wayanad and travel extensively within the district.
